Norway - Norway - Hydroelectricity: About half of Norway’s 65,000 largest lakes are situated at elevations of at least 1,650 feet (500 metres); about one-fifth of the country lies 2,950 feet (900 metres) or more above sea level; and predominantly westerly winds create abundant precipitation. The results reported here are part of a joint study on possible ecological effects in the delta area of Lake Randsfjorden, Southern Norway, caused by a reduction in water flow as a result of hydroelectric power development.From 1988 to 1990 the mean daily water flow decreased sharply and the total load of suspended matter was greatly reduced. A country well known for its high mountain plateaus, abundant natural lakes and steep valleys and fjords, Norway’s topography lends itself perfectly to hydropower development. The hydropower station with the highest annual average power production in Norway in 2019 was Tonstad hydro power station, which had an annual output of around 4.4 terawatt hours.
